Transaction 868626991b2ae72e3efc2f54c0a7df9af3cc4aea85b350658acafe69bc760d6c
1 Input
1 Output
-
868626991b2ae72e3efc2f54c0a7df9af3cc4aea85b350658acafe69bc760d6c:0
- value
- 20780
- script pubkey
- OP_0 OP_PUSHBYTES_20 35afc1100d614e3f276104e204452a71d2bc2f59
- address
- bc1qxkhuzyqdv98r7fmpqn3qg3f2w8ftct6ep4q93m